What is the minimum number of bits needed to encode the days ofthe
month in a Canadian calendar.

1.

5

2.

3

3.

6

4.

4

Answer & Explanation Solved by verified expert
4.0 Ratings (694 Votes)
Answer is 5 bits Consider the following case You have to count whole numbers less than 4 in binary A 1bit binary can have 2 values exclusively either 0 or 1 With 2 bits we can have 4 possible combinatios Decimal Binary 1 bit can count 2values 0 1 0 1 2bits can count 4 values 0123 00 01 10 11 nbits can have 2n combinations    See Answer
